Die Maker Assistant – Winston-Salem Manufacturing
Shift: 3rd shift
Summary:
The Die Maker Assistant position is responsible for assisting in producing top quality Die Boards for Manufacturing.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following:
Responsible for assembling and inspecting strippers and adding proper rubber to dies.Assemble and inspect rubber dies.Stage dies and strippers for receiving to pick up.Revise and repair die and strippers.Cut corrugated samples on roller press.Maintain inventory and stock supplies.Responsible for the overall Safety and cleanliness of equipment and area.Work in a safe and efficient manner in accordance with company policies and procedures.Overtime is required.Perform other duties as assigned.
